Legionellosis is a lung infection caused by _Legionella_ bacteria. Infection is mainly by inhalation of contaminated water spray. After an incubation period of 2-10 days, the patient feels as if infected by influenza, with a cough, initially unproductive, which then gives way to severe pneumonia requiring hospitalization.
The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region is one of the most affected regions with the highest incidence at national level: 2.7 cases per 100 000 inhabitants in 2016 (212 cases)
